    module: prepare to handle ROX allocations for text

    In order to support ROX allocations for module text, it is necessary to
    handle modifications to the code, such as relocations and alternatives
    patching, without write access to that memory.

    One option is to use text patching, but this would make module loading
    extremely slow and will expose executable code that is not finally formed.

    A better way is to have memory allocated with ROX permissions contain
    invalid instructions and keep a writable, but not executable copy of the
    module text.  The relocations and alternative patches would be done on the
    writable copy using the addresses of the ROX memory.  Once the module is
    completely ready, the updated text will be copied to ROX memory using text
    patching in one go and the writable copy will be freed.

    Add support for that to module initialization code and provide necessary
    interfaces in execmem.

// SPDX-License-Identifier: GPL-2.0-or-later
/*
* Module kmemleak support
*
* Copyright (C) 2009 Catalin Marinas
*/
#include <linux/module.h>
#include <linux/kmemleak.h>
#include "internal.h"
void kmemleak_load_module(const struct module *mod,
const struct load_info *info)
{
/* only scan writable, non-executable sections */
for_each_mod_mem_type(type) {
if (type != MOD_DATA && type != MOD_INIT_DATA &&
!mod->mem[type].is_rox)
kmemleak_no_scan(mod->mem[type].base);
}
}
